Today in the Times-Standard : Hate Groups show growth

How far have we really come in regards to racial hatred in America today?

On one hand we've elected the first African-American President, and on the other, He (Obama) is being hung in effigy, and the target for assassination pools across the country.

The KKK is bragging about their sudden re-emergence with overloaded web sites devoted to hatred.

The FBI has been tracking the progress of these hate groups and are reporting a huge increase in racially motivated incidents throughout America.

 So how far have we really come?
